We were commissioned as a community anchor research organisation by Birmingham City Council to work on a community-led collaborative action learning report.
This work was designed to help build a strategy for the ‘Levelling Up’ funding for East Birmingham Regeneration 💚
We then collated the research and commissioned Grand Union studio artist Sarah Taylor Silverwood to work with the community to design a 'Visual “community voice” Action Plan' to make visible the voices that are not usually heard in city planning for community support decisions.
‘Sebastia Disagreement’ by Yiru Qian is one of the films we’re screening as part of Screening Rights Film Fest. This film unpacks the occupation of Masudiya and Sebastia stations, once crucial sites for Palestinian agricultural activity.🚂
